How to Choose a Washdown Touch Screen for Food Manufacturing

Food manufacturing touch screens must survive cleaning cycles, gloves, wet hands, oil mist, temperature changes and long shifts while helping operators run production lines safely. The best touch screen for food manufacturing is not simply the brightest display or the cheapest panel. It is a sealed, cleanable and validated HMI that fits the machine, the sanitation process and the operator workflow.

Food and beverage equipment usually needs a cleanable front surface, stable touch performance and a structure that supports washdown maintenance.

Quick Selection Answer

For food manufacturing and washdown automation, choose an industrial PCAP touch screen monitor or touch panel PC with IP65 or higher front protection, stainless steel or corrosion-resistant housing where required, glove and wet touch support, durable tempered cover glass and a mounting structure that avoids dirt traps. For high-pressure washdown or strict sanitation zones, review the full enclosure, not only the front IP rating.

Food Production Environments Need Different HMI Choices

AreaTypical ExposureRecommended Display DirectionKey Check
Dry packaging lineDust, frequent touch, long shifts.Industrial touch monitor with durable glass and easy cleaning.Touch accuracy and operator readability.
Wet processing areaWater, gloves, condensation and cleaning spray.IP65 front or higher, wet touch tuning and sealed front structure.Water film touch test and gasket design.
Sanitation washdown zoneDetergent, disinfectant and repeated wiping.Stainless or corrosion-resistant housing, chemical review and smooth front surface.Cleaner compatibility and no dirt-trap design.
Cold room or temperature transitionCondensation and cold starts.Wide-temperature display, sealed structure and controlled thermal design.Power-up test after cold soak and humidity exposure.

Key Specification Areas

Cleanable Mechanical Design

Food plants care about sanitation and uptime. A smooth front surface, sealed edge, controlled gasket and suitable housing material reduce places where water, dust or residue can collect. If stainless steel is needed, confirm grade, finish and enclosure details instead of assuming all metal housings behave the same.

Glove and Wet Touch Operation

Operators may use nitrile gloves, wet gloves or insulated gloves. PCAP touch can support these conditions when the sensor, controller, glass thickness and firmware are matched. Test with the actual glove type and UI layout before production.

Ingress and Chemical Review

IP65 front protection is common for wet or cleaning-prone HMIs, but the complete machine protection depends on rear cover, cable gland, connector direction and installation angle. Cleaning chemicals can also affect coatings, labels and plastics, so material compatibility should be reviewed early.

Readability and Operator Speed

A clear HMI reduces operator error. Use adequate brightness, wide viewing angle, high contrast UI and cover glass treatment if overhead lights cause glare. Optical bonding may help in bright or condensation-prone areas.

Food Manufacturing Touch Screen Specification Table

SpecificationPractical Starting PointWhen to Upgrade
Front ratingIP65 front for wet or cleaning-prone equipment.Higher sealing or full enclosure review for washdown zones.
Touch technologyPCAP with glove and wet touch validation.Special tuning for thick gloves or heavy water film.
HousingIndustrial metal housing or stainless front assembly.Stainless enclosure for sanitation or corrosion-prone areas.
Brightness350 to 500 nits for indoor factory use.700+ nits or bonding for high ambient light or outdoor-facing lines.
InterfaceHDMI/VGA/DP plus USB touch, or integrated panel PC.Panel PC if the machine needs integrated computing and I/O.

Validation Before Factory Rollout

  • Touch operation with the actual glove type used by operators.
  • Cleaning wipe test with approved plant chemicals.
  • Water spray or humidity test according to the installation zone.
  • Readability check under overhead lighting and line position.
  • Service replacement test using the final mounting structure.

FAQ

What touch screen is best for food manufacturing?

An industrial PCAP touch screen with IP65 or higher front protection, cleanable cover glass and glove or wet touch validation is usually the best starting point.

Do food factory HMIs need stainless steel?

Not always. Stainless steel is important in washdown, sanitation or corrosion-prone zones. Dry packaging lines may use other industrial housings if they meet cleaning and durability needs.

Can operators use gloves on a capacitive touch screen?

Yes, if the PCAP sensor, controller, glass thickness and firmware are matched. The final design should be tested with the actual glove used in the plant.
